KPEL (AM)
KPEL (1420 AM, "ESPN Lafayette") is a radio station licensed to serve Lafayette, Louisiana. The station is owned by Townsquare Media and licensed to Townsquare Media of Lafayette, LLC. It airs a sports radio format featuring programming from ESPN Radio.[1] Its studios are located on Bertrand Road in Lafayette, and its transmitter is located about two miles north of the studios.

The station was assigned the KPEL call letters by the Federal Communications Commission on July 1, 1957.[2]
The station is the base of the Great S.C.O.T.T. Show with Scott Prather. The station serves as the flagship station of Louisiana Ragin' Cajun Athletics, airing UL football, men's and women's basketball, baseball, and softball games.
